anemic means low hemoglobin. hemoglobin binds oxygen and carries it to your tissues and your baby's developing tissues. therefore, anemia means baby gets less oxygen while in utero. You will/can be fatigued/cold/short of breath. Baby can have developmental issues. The iron isn't that bad, promise. [ Reply | More ]
